Steam & Excursion > Fate leads me to Milwaukee 261Date: 07/26/15 15:06 Fate leads me to Milwaukee 261 Author: 90mac While driving towards BNSF Northtown Yard on University Avenue in Minneapolis 2 Sundays ago my path was blocked by at traffic collision.
I was in the right lane so I turned right and decided to get closer to the BNSF tracks. I remembered a place called Minneapolis Junction was close by and I drove that way. I turn on a street and I can see crossing gates ahead going down so I pull up and park,jump out to take a photo. I photographed the BNSF grainer and as I was turning to leave I see the nose of a Steam Locomotive sticking out of a building! I drove over and talked to the friendly fellows working on 261 for a while. It was a memorable first visit to the Twin Cities. Was it Luck? I think not.
